QUOTE(xeon1989 @ Apr 14 2021, 12:39 PM) Bought AX3600. Disable WiFi 6 and force 20Mhz mode for the 2.4Ghz band on the Xiaomi AX3600 and hope for the best. You can play around with channels but I doubt that will help a lot.Noticed that with a single device connected to 2.4G wifi, the speed is awesome. Ping from PC to router 192.168.31.1 less than 1ms. After I connect all my IoT and IP Cam (~10 devices) which supports only 2.4G wifi, ping from PC become ~600ms and frequently disconnected. However, if I connect my PC to 5G wifi, it's smooth again. But I can't connect to 5G wifi with my phone as it doesn't cover every corner in my house (such as toilet) :| Is this the slow 2.4G wifi a common issue for AX3600? Even with my very old TL-WR740N, it can easily handle more than 10 devices without hiccup... The Qualcomm based 2.4Ghz radio on the Xiaomi AX3600 isn't that great. There's actually better WiFi router at this price point unless you absolutely need Mi Home integration. |
